2 Radiators Setup, who should i connect them??
 
i coulnd get any big radiator, so i got 2 12cm x 12cm radiadorts.


how should i connect them, in parallel or in line??

g.l.amour 01-15-2003 09:43 AM

in parallel it should work better... but only marginally. i did the test with 2 rads parallel or serial, and with the temp measurement equipment i had at that time, i couldn't spot any difference.

a serial setup is easier to bleed (requires a less powerfull pump), because the flow isn't cut in half at the point the tubes divide in 2.

so really, if i were to do it all again, i would have left it serial. instead of having bought a 100$ pump + all the hassle of rerouting (i am offcourse forgetting the fun i had doing it all).
